She was determined early on and carved out a professional life for herself. To her help, she had father Andreas, provincial doctor in Visby who followed the debate on women&#8217;s rights in the Visby Weekly. He read up on the political events in countries such as England, Germany and France. Both his daughters had the talent to become successful musicians. She began organ studies at the music conservatory, which only a few years earlier had started accepting female students. Two years later, she became the first woman in Sweden to graduate as an organist. When she then applied for a job, and was rejected, the desire to enter male territories only grew. She applied with her father&#8217;s help to become a telegraph operator. After a long correspondence with the Swedish Telegraph Agency&#8217;s director general, she got her way. In 1867, the cathedral organist position in Gothenburg was advertised. Elfrida Andr\u00e9e applied in strong competition with seven men and got the position, as the first female cathedral organist in Europe. To Elfrida Andr\u00e9e&#8217;s side rushed, among others, editor-in-chief of Gothenburg&#8217;s Handels- och Sj\u00f6farts Tidning, the very liberal politician and writer S.A. Hedlund (1821\u20131900). Elfrida quickly became a member of his circle of friends.<\/span><span data-ccp-props=\"{&quot;201341983&quot;:0,&quot;335559739&quot;:160,&quot;335559740&quot;:259}\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-contrast=\"none\">Elfrida Andr\u00e9e stayed in Gothenburg for the rest of her life and remained the city&#8217;s cathedral organist until her death.
